Seattle: The Historic Headquarters

The story of Amazon corporate office locations begins and remains most significantly in Seattle, Washington. The city is home to the Day 1 Academy and the iconic Day 1 building complex in South Lake Union, which houses thousands of employees. This campus serves as the primary headquarters and the birthplace of the company’s core business units, including its dominant marketplace and the foundational technology driving its cloud services.

Major East Coast Operations

To support its massive customer base in the United States, Amazon maintains significant corporate office locations on the East Coast. Northern Virginia hosts a substantial presence near the D.C. metropolitan area, focusing on public policy, government relations, and regional management. New York City also hosts key corporate functions, particularly within the advertising and Kindle divisions, leveraging the city's status as a global media and financial hub.

Expanding Midwest and Southern Presence

Amazon's expansion strategy is evident in its growing corporate office locations across the Midwest and South. Chicago serves as a major regional headquarters, overseeing operations across the central United States. The company has also established significant offices in the Dallas-Fort Worth metroplex, reflecting the strategic importance of Texas in the company's future growth plans for both retail and AWS infrastructure.

Global Infrastructure and International Hubs

The scope of Amazon corporate office locations extends far beyond North America to support its international retail and AWS customers. Cities like London, England, and Dublin, Ireland, host critical European headquarters, managing compliance, sales, and engineering for a vast international user base. Additional development centers in India and other global hotspots fuel the innovation required for a company of this magnitude.
